Mutation details: The transgenic construct consisted of cDNA encoding cre recombinase adjoined to the mouse Krt2-6a promoter. Cre-mediated recombination was observed in the companion cell layer of hair follicles, a discrete cell population located between the inner and outer root sheaths. With retinoic acid treatment, the expression domain is expanded to the interfollicular basal and outer root sheath cells.
(J:88795)
